How FHA Refinance Works
FHA refinance replaces your current mortgage with a new FHA loan. Depending on the option, it may allow lower credit scores, higher debt to income ratios, and more flexible approval criteria than conventional loans.
However, FHA loans include mortgage insurance premiums. This means the lowest rate is not always the lowest total cost. The decision should be based on the full payment, loan structure, and long term plan.

FHA Refinance Requirements
FHA refinance guidelines can vary depending on the specific program, but typically include:
Credit
Often more flexible than conventional loans.
Debt to Income
Higher ratios may be allowed depending on the file.
Mortgage Insurance
Required on most FHA loans and should be factored into total cost.
Property Type
Typically primary residences, with some limitations compared to conventional loans.

Frequently Asked Questions About FHA Refinance
Is FHA refinance easier to qualify for?
In many cases yes, especially for borrowers with lower credit scores or higher debt ratios.
Does FHA refinance require an appraisal?
Some FHA streamline refinances may not require a full appraisal, depending on the situation.
Is FHA always better than conventional?
No. FHA is sometimes easier to qualify for, but conventional loans may have lower long term costs.
